Concept- Ozone is present in the stratosphere layer of the atmosphere. It protects the earth from the harmful layer of the sun. Gasses like CFCs, Nitrogenous compounds, and NO2, NO depletes ozone and creates a hole in the ozone.
It results in the direct reaching of UV light to the earth’s surface. It may cause skin cancer and even mutation in DNA.
Ozone is three molecule of the oxygen and depleting day by day. The most dangerous component for the ozone layer is the chlorofluorocarbon gas. To prevent more depletion of the ozone layer government banned the electronics or the objects that release chlorofluorocarbon gas.
